Name: _____________________ Date:_____________________ How to Calculate Population Density by Antony Caruso DEFINITION population density - ___________________________________________________ ___________________________________________________ ___________________________________________________ ___________________________________________________ FORMULA population density = population ÷ area - the answer is always expressed as people per km2 or people/km2 EXAMPLE The country of Bulgaria has a population of 7 037 935. The country has an area of 110 879 km2. What is the population density of Bulgaria? alwayswritetheformulafirst population density = population ÷ area = 7 037 935 ÷ 110 879 km2 substitutethepropervalues = 63.4740122 people/km2 = 63.47 people/km2 roundyouranswertotwodecimal placesandusetheproperunit sparsedensity=<15people/km2 moderatedensity=15-150people/km2 densedensity=150+people/km2 PRACTICE Calculate the population densities for the following countries. Round to two decimal places.
